Report: Tyson Jackson's Contract Biggest in Chiefs History

KANSAS CITY, MO - MAY 9: First round draft choice Tyson Jackson #94 of the Kansas City Chiefs is interviewed following a rookie minicamp at the Chiefs practice facility on May 9, 2009 in Kansas City, Missouri. (Photo by G. Newman Lowrance/Getty Images)

So says Nick Wright from 610 Sports:

610 learns that the deal with DE Tyson Jackson will make him highest paid Chief in team history (on an annual basis).

The highest deal in team history would top the $28 million guaranteed to Kansas City Chiefs QB Matt Cassel last month. But...I'm not sure how that "on annual basis" caveat in the 610 Sports quote is going to settle out. Cassel's contract was a six-year deal so I'm guessing that's what they mean.

We're speculating that the deal is somewhere between $28-30 million guaranteed, which is just slightly less than the #2 overall pick Jason Smith received from the Rams.
